Education: Bachelor of Science, Electrical Engineering Alma mater: Auburn University Jeffrey Atwell has over 30 years of experience in the design, planning, construction, operation and maintenance of electrical systems and facilities. He is a seasoned Project Manager and Engineer and has extensive experience in the planning, design and construction, and operation and maintenance of transmission, distribution and substation facilities for electric utility clients and electrical facilities for commercial, industrial, educational, institutional and maritime projects. Mr. Atwell has served as Project Manager for electrical and communication infrastructure improvements for the Port of Gulfport Restoration Program, a $560 million renovation project in Gulfport, Mississippi. The project required demolition and reconstruction of existing electrical, communication and site lighting at the Port of Gulfport. Mr. Atwell has also served as Project Manager for Advanced Meter Infrastructure projects for Clarksdale Public Utilities and Kosciusko Water & Light.

Education: Bachelor of Science, Electrical Engineering Alma mater: Mississippi State University William D. Gent has over 25 years of experience in the design, planning, construction, operation and maintenance of electrical systems and facilities. He is a seasoned Project Manager and Engineer with extensive experience with medium and high voltage power systems, water and sanitary sewer facility power and control systems, and supervisory control and data automation (SCADA) systems. Among other projects, Mr. Gent has served as Project Manager for protective relaying, control and SCADA renovations at the Okolona 161/46 kV Primary substation located in Chickasaw County. Mr. Gent also served as Project Manager for protective relaying, control and SCADA renovations at the Mississippi State University 69/13 kV substation and 26 MW generation plant.
